SPORTS CARNIVAL IN POTTSTOWN

When: Sunday from 2 to 6 p.m. Where: Pottstown Memorial Park, 75 W. King St. More Details: The free community event is part of the borough’s GoFourth Festival! activities. There will be fitness games such as jumping rope, volleyball and an obstacle course. The event will also have sport demonstrat­ions, prizes, food, music and more. HEALTH STEPS IN MORGANTOWN

When: Every Monday at 9 a.m. Where: Village Library, 207 N. Walnut St.

More Details: The free class is called “Healthy Steps in Motion.” It focuses on moving and stretching. For more informatio­n, visit the website www.villagelib­rary.org or call 610-286-1022.

JULY 4TH PADDLE & FIREWORKS

When: Tuesday from 2 to 11 p.m.

Where: Black Rock Boat Launch, 1050 Black Rock Road More Details: Participan­ts of the holiday kayaking event will travel 12½ miles at a leisurely pace then watch the Phoenixvil­le fireworks. The cost is $50 is you own a kayak and $90 if you need to rent one. People must reserve a spot.
